What Mathematical Scientists Do
All data scientists and mathematical scientists not listed separately.
Mathematical Scientist Salaries
- 2020 employment: 63,200
- May 2021 median annual wage: $100,480
Job Outlook for Mathematical Scientists
Projected employment change, 2020-30:
- Number of new jobs: 19,800
- Growth rate: 31 percent (Much faster than average)
How to Become A Mathematical Scientist
Education and training:
- Typical entry-level education: Bachelor's degree
- Work experience in a related occupation: None
- Typical on-the-job training: None
